引言
在Android开发领域,代码的优化和性能提升一直是开发者关注的焦点。随着移动设备的快速发展,用户对应用的响应速度和流畅度有了更高的要求。本文将介绍一种名为“一码包中9点20公开”的方法,该方法通过广泛的解释落实,旨在提高Android应用的性能和用户体验。
一码包中9点20公开概述
“一码包中9点20公开”是一种针对Android应用性能优化的方法论,它涵盖了代码优化、资源管理、内存控制等多个方面。该方法的核心思想是在代码层面进行深入分析,找出性能瓶颈,并针对性地进行优化。
代码优化
代码优化是“一码包中9点20公开”方法的首要环节。在Android应用开发中,代码的效率直接影响到应用的运行速度。代码优化包括以下几个方面:
1. 减少不必要的对象创建:对象创建是消耗CPU资源的操作,减少不必要的对象创建可以提高应用性能。
2. 优化循环和递归:在循环和递归中,减少不必要的计算和条件判断,可以提高代码的执行效率。
3. 使用合适的数据结构:选择合适的数据结构可以减少内存消耗,提高数据处理速度。
资源管理
资源管理是“一码包中9点20公开”方法的另一个重要方面。Android应用在运行过程中会消耗大量的系统资源,如CPU、内存、存储空间等。合理的资源管理可以避免资源浪费,提高应用性能。
1. 合理使用线程:多线程可以提高应用的并发处理能力,但过多的线程会导致资源竞争和上下文切换,影响性能。
2. 优化内存使用:内存是Android应用运行的重要资源,优化内存使用可以避免内存泄漏和溢出,提高应用稳定性。
3. 管理磁盘存储:合理管理磁盘存储空间,避免不必要的文件读写操作,可以提高应用的I/O性能。
内存控制
内存控制是“一码包中9点20公开”方法的关键环节。Android应用在运行过程中,会占用大量的内存资源。合理的内存控制可以避免内存泄漏和溢出,提高应用稳定性。
1. 使用弱引用:弱引用是一种特殊的引用类型,它允许垃圾回收器在内存不足时回收被引用的对象。
2. 优化Bitmap处理:Bitmap是Android中常用的图像处理类,合理的Bitmap处理可以减少内存消耗,提高应用性能。
3. 使用内存分析工具:内存分析工具可以帮助开发者发现内存泄漏和溢出的问题,及时进行优化。
广泛解释落实方法
“一码包中9点20公开”方法的广泛解释落实,是指在实际开发过程中,将该方法论应用到项目的各个环节,确保性能优化的全面性和有效性。
1. 代码层面的优化:在代码编写阶段,就要遵循“一码包中9点20公开”的方法论,进行性能优化。
2. 测试阶段的优化:在测试阶段,要使用性能测试工具,对应用进行全面的性能测试,发现性能瓶颈,并进行优化。
3. 发布后的优化:在应用发布后,要持续关注应用的性能表现,根据用户反馈和性能监控数据,进行持续的优化。
Android 256.183版本优化实践
在Android 256.183版本中,“一码包中9点20公开”方法得到了广泛的应用和实践。以下是一些具体的优化实践:
1. 代码层面的优化:在Android 256.183版本中,对核心库进行了代码重构,减少了冗余代码,提高了代码的执行效率。
2. 资源管理的优化:在Android 256.183版本中,对线程池进行了优化,减少了线程创建和销毁的开销,提高了并发处理能力。
3. 内存控制的优化:在Android 256.183版本中,对Bitmap处理进行了优化,减少了内存消耗,提高了图像处理速度。
总结
“一码包中9点20公开”方法是一种全面的性能优化方法论,它涵盖了代码优化、资源管理、内存控制等多个方面。通过广泛的解释落实,该方法论可以帮助开发者提高Android应用的性能和用户体验。在实际开发过程中,开发者应该遵循该方法论,进行全面的性能优化
还没有评论,来说两句吧...